The Current Landscape of U.S.-Iran Relations

In the latest developments, tensions between the United States and Iran have escalated dramatically. Following comments from former President Donald Trump suggesting the cease-fire was "over," the U.S. has launched renewed military actions targeting Iranian interests. This has prompted Iran to declare that it will retaliate, significantly heightening the stakes in an already volatile region.

These tensions are not merely a matter of military engagement; they have profound implications for global stability, particularly in the energy sector. With oil prices already fluctuating due to uncertainty, any further escalation could lead to sustained economic impacts across the world, especially in Southeast Asia where economies are reliant on stable energy supplies.

Impacts on the Geopolitical Landscape

The military exchanges between the U.S. and Iran have the potential to disrupt not just the immediate region but also broader geopolitical dynamics. Analysts highlight that Iran's response, which could come in various forms including cyber-attacks or proxy engagements in areas where it has influence, poses a threat to U.S. interests globally.

Countries within the ASEAN framework, particularly nations like Indonesia and Malaysia, are closely monitoring the situation. Jakarta's strategic position in global shipping routes makes it particularly sensitive to disruptions in the Persian Gulf, where oil tankers frequently traverse.
